CLINTON — Swayne Cole, 81, of Clinton died at 3:10 a.m. Saturday, Jan. 12, 2013, at Parkway Regional Hospital in Fulton.
He was a member of Oakton United Methodist Church, a 32nd degree Shriner, and a member of Eastern Star and Hickman Masonic Lodge 131 F&AM. He was a machinist at Ingersoll-Rand.
He is survived by his wife, Darce Snead Cole of Humboldt, Tenn.; and two sisters, Ruth Curlin and Louise Martin, both of Clinton.
He was preceded in death by his first wife, Brenda Henson Cole; and one brother. His parents were Robert D. Cole and Mable Dean Gibson Cole.
Services will be at 1 p.m. Monday, Jan. 14, 2013, at Brown Funeral Home in Clinton with the Rev. Vida McClure officiating. Burial will follow in Oakwood Cemetery.
Friends may call after 11 a.m. Monday at the funeral home. Masonic rites will be at 10:30 a.m. Monday at the funeral home. Donations can be made to Oakwood Cemetery, c/o Eddie Roberts, 2265 Hickman Road, Clinton, KY 42031.
